Job Description What You’ll Do: Reporting to the Manager, Digital Solutions, you'll be responsible for implementing designs as directed by senior team members. This includes developing Salesforce applications and maintaining existing production configurations, while navigating through all stages of the software development lifecycle. The core parts of your role will be to: Work closely with internal team members and external partners in the design, development, and implementation of business solutions leveraging the Salesforce technologies. Configure and develop Salesforce multi-cloud CRM solutions that support OTIP initiatives. Collaborate with key stakeholders across the business, identify and gather their requirements and needs, and translate them into technical specifications and Salesforce CRM solutions. Configure necessary Salesforce solutions to meet business requirements. Design, develop, and maintain custom Salesforce UI and programming logic in LWC and Apex. Develop, maintain, and optimize API-based integrations between Salesforce CRM and other systems, ensuring data integrity and seamless data flow. Conduct testing, troubleshooting, and regression activities to ensure reliability and performance of Salesforce CRM solutions. Qualifications Let’s Talk About You: This is the unique blend of skills and experience we would love to see in an ideal candidate: Completion of at least 1 post‑secondary education in a related field. Certified Salesforce Platform Developer or equivalent. At least 2 years of development experience working with Salesforce CRM platforms. Experience developing solutions for Sales Cloud, Service Cloud, Marketing Cloud, CMS, Knowledge, and Experience Cloud (authenticated and unauthenticated). Experience with multi‑lingual Salesforce implementation is a highly desired asset. Strong understanding of Salesforce sharing and security, including but not limited to roles, profiles, permissions. Proficiency with Salesforce.com, Apex, Lightning Web Component and other Salesforce customization toolsets. Demonstrate understanding of cloud technology fundamentals and cloud‑based security concepts. Knowledge of agile methodologies and tools. Highly analytical individual with advanced problem‑solving skills and strong attention to detail. Highly motivated communicator with strong customer service acumen, capable of coordinating multiple external technology and business partners. Knowledge of Azure DevOps, and DevOps processes & toolsets (like Gearset, Copado). The ability to communicate in French is considered an asset.
